About  Box Components

Components for enclosures and boxes, known as box components, serve to expand the functionality and utility of these protective casings. They encompass a diverse array of features and elements, including drawers, mounting options, side panels, PC boards, bases, shelves, terminals, windows, plates, power entry modules, filters, DIN rails, and more. When selecting box components, various factors come into play, including the manufacturer, product series, the specific feature being added, dimensions, color, composition material, and the related products for which they are intended. By carefully considering these factors, users can tailor the enclosure to meet their unique requirements and specifications. Drawers, for instance, provide convenient storage within the enclosure, allowing for organization and easy access to tools, spare parts, or other essential items. Mounting features and side panels facilitate the installation and secure placement of internal components, optimizing the use of space within the enclosure and providing structural support. PC boards, bases, and shelves offer platforms for mounting electronic equipment and devices, enabling efficient organization and utilization of space within the enclosure. Terminals, windows, and plates contribute to the accessibility and visibility of internal components, supporting maintenance and monitoring activities. Power entry modules, filters, and DIN rails provide essential infrastructure for power distribution, electrical filtering, and component mounting, ensuring the proper functioning and integration of electrical systems within the enclosure. Each of these box components plays a vital role in expanding the capabilities and adaptability of enclosures and boxes, effectively meeting the specific needs of different applications.
